Normal Distribution
A symmetrical, bell-shaped distribution of data in which most of the data points are concentrated around the mean, with the tails of the distribution tapering off symmetrically at both ends.

Bell Curve
A graphical depiction of a normal distribution, where most occurrences take place near the mean and fewer occur as you move away from the mean.
Psychological Characteristics
Attributes of an individual's mental and emotional state that determine their thoughts, feelings, and behaviors.
